Output 8e6f788b54df831d57b5c6a13b5763c75e88ed7e617408c6be94c742b814541f:55

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a62eae809f656ba41176a8c3b2b977e1a8a1bb68866a62e75d3594997c4ba19d
address
bc1p5ch2aqylv446gytk4rpm9wthux52rwmgse4x9e6axk2fjlzt5xwsr9auq3
transaction
8e6f788b54df831d57b5c6a13b5763c75e88ed7e617408c6be94c742b814541f
spent
true